diff options
author | vvvv <vvvv@yandex-team.com> | 2025-01-29 16:58:30 +0300 |
---|---|---|
committer | vvvv <vvvv@yandex-team.com> | 2025-01-29 17:42:35 +0300 |
commit | 12394c9c74f3eef93303aefdfe3a2af02c48315a (patch) | |
tree | c6f6b0fe55ca949cc3af10b4e206e638c4befb80 /yql/essentials/minikql/mkql_program_builder.cpp | |
parent | 13d12a0d4b3448c8956d46b7a0155d043f006acf (diff) | |
download | ydb-12394c9c74f3eef93303aefdfe3a2af02c48315a.tar.gz |
drop BlockBitCast YQL-19494
commit_hash:1b627ad95e1026d9c67f004825ef1567504cc66e
Diffstat (limited to 'yql/essentials/minikql/mkql_program_builder.cpp')
-rw-r--r-- | yql/essentials/minikql/mkql_program_builder.cpp | 11 |
1 files changed, 0 insertions, 11 deletions
diff --git a/yql/essentials/minikql/mkql_program_builder.cpp b/yql/essentials/minikql/mkql_program_builder.cpp index ee9812c4f9..d7df4981b3 100644 --- a/yql/essentials/minikql/mkql_program_builder.cpp +++ b/yql/essentials/minikql/mkql_program_builder.cpp @@ -5756,17 +5756,6 @@ TRuntimeNode TProgramBuilder::BlockFunc(const std::string_view& funcName, TType* return TRuntimeNode(builder.Build(), false); } -TRuntimeNode TProgramBuilder::BlockBitCast(TRuntimeNode value, TType* targetType) { - MKQL_ENSURE(value.GetStaticType()->IsBlock(), "Expected Block type"); - - auto returnType = TBlockType::Create(targetType, AS_TYPE(TBlockType, value.GetStaticType())->GetShape(), Env); - TCallableBuilder builder(Env, __func__, returnType); - builder.Add(value); - builder.Add(TRuntimeNode(targetType, true)); - - return TRuntimeNode(builder.Build(), false); -} - TRuntimeNode TProgramBuilder::BuildBlockCombineAll(const std::string_view& callableName, TRuntimeNode input, std::optional<ui32> filterColumn, const TArrayRef<const TAggInfo>& aggs, TType* returnType) { const auto inputType = input.GetStaticType(); |